José Jun Martínez is a Puerto Rican-born, London-based painter whose work explores our emotional and sensory relationship with the natural world. In this film, José discusses his use of textural mark-making as a reflection of the environment, how he works with a reduced palette to create a full spectrum of colours, and how the scale of his paintings can create a sense of being swallowed by the work, fully immersed in his lush expression of nature.
